php - 如何在 PHP 中获取字符串中的字符数?

标签 php string localization utf-8 character-encoding

它是 UTF-8。 例如,情报是2个字符,而ラリーペイジ是6个字符。

最佳答案

代码

$a = "情報";
$b = "ラリーペイジ";

echo mb_strlen($a, 'UTF-8') . "\n";
echo mb_strlen($b, 'UTF-8') . "\n";

结果

2
6

关于php - 如何在 PHP 中获取字符串中的字符数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1998638/

相关文章:

php - 如何从 joomla url 中隐藏 id

PHP:来自与变量(变量-变量)连接的字符串的新变量

php - 查找字符串的一部分并输出整个字符串

ios - swift 中的本地化错误(翻译)

c# - MessageBox 按钮 - 设置语言?

PHP在网页上查看PDF并禁止用户下载

php - mysql_fetch_array()/mysql_fetch_assoc()/mysql_fetch_row()/mysql_num_rows 等...期望参数 1 是资源

ruby-on-rails - 用 ' & ' 替换字符串中的最后一个逗号 - Ruby

python 无法理解通过 Winsock 发送的 C++ 字符串

localization - 如何将所有 XIB 文件中的所有可本地化字符串提取到一个文件中?